What are Spark Ads and why do they outperform standard TikTok ads?
Spark Ads let brands boost organic creator posts directly from the creator's account rather than running ads from the brand account. This native format maintains the authentic look and feel of organic content while reaching larger audiences. The format achieves 134% higher completion rates because viewers engage with content that feels like natural TikTok posts rather than obvious advertising. Brands get the credibility of creator endorsement combined with the targeting power of paid media.
How do influencer marketing platforms simplify the Spark Ads authorization process?
Running Spark Ads requires creators to generate authorization codes that give brands permission to boost their content. Without platform support, this involves manual outreach, waiting for responses, and tracking codes in spreadsheets.
